The Complete Guide to Lockout/Tagout Compliance in Australia:

Signs, Tags & Isolation Procedures

Every year, workers across Australia are seriously injured — or killed — because energy sources were not properly isolated before maintenance work began. Lockout/tagout sign (LOTO) procedures exist to prevent exactly this. And at the heart of any effective LOTO system is clear, unambiguous signage and tagging.

Whether you are a WHS manager reviewing your isolation procedures, a maintenance supervisor preparing for a shutdown, or a safety officer auditing your site’s compliance, this guide covers everything you need to know about LOTO signs, tags and your legal obligations under Australian workplace health and safety law.

What Is Lockout/Tagout (LOTO) and Why Does It Matter?

Lockout/Tagout is a safety procedure used to ensure that dangerous machinery and equipment is properly shut off and rendered unable to be re-energised before maintenance, servicing or cleaning work is performed. It applies to any energy source — electrical, hydraulic, pneumatic, thermal, gravitational or chemical.

Under the Work Health and Safety Regulations 2017, managing the risks of plant and machinery includes establishing written safe work procedures for isolation. LOTO signage and tags are a core physical control in those procedures. Without them, a verbal instruction or a note on a whiteboard is not a compliant isolation system.

The Difference Between Lockout Tags and Lockout Signs

It is a distinction that matters — and one that is often misunderstood:

Lockout Tags

A lockout tag is a physical tag attached to an isolation point (switch, valve, circuit breaker) during maintenance work to communicate that the energy source has been isolated and must not be re-energised. Tags identify who applied the isolation, when it was applied, and why.

Tags alone are a secondary control — they should always be used alongside a physical locking device where possible. However, in many situations (particularly for quick maintenance tasks or where locking devices are not compatible with the isolation point), tags serve as the primary communication tool.

Lockout Signs

Lockout signs are fixed signs installed at or near isolation points, switchboards, or equipment that requires LOTO procedures. Common examples include:

  • ‘Do Not Operate’ signs
  • ‘Danger – Equipment Being Serviced’ signs
  • ‘Isolation Point’ identification signs
  • ‘Lockout Procedure’ instruction signs

What Does Australian Law Require for Lockout / Tagout?

The WHS Regulations require that a person conducting a business or undertaking (PCBU) must manage risks associated with the unexpected start-up or uncontrolled release of stored energy. This includes:

  • Implementing written isolation procedures for all relevant plant and machinery.
  • Ensuring energy sources can be identified and isolated before maintenance begins.
  • Using lockout/tagout devices to secure the isolation point.
  • Providing workers with the information, instruction, training and supervision needed to perform LOTO safely.

The primary Australian Standard for energy isolation is AS/NZS 4024.1503, which specifies requirements for the identification of isolation devices, lockout points and stored energy hazards. AS1319 governs the format, colour and placement of all signs used in the LOTO system.

What LOTO Signage Does Your Site Need?

A compliant LOTO system typically requires a combination of fixed signs and portable tags. Here are the four sign types every site should have:

1. Isolation Point Identification Signs

Mounted permanently at or directly adjacent to each energy isolation device, these signs identify what the isolator controls, the energy type, and the isolation state when LOTO is applied. Without these, maintenance workers cannot quickly confirm they have isolated the correct energy source.

2. Danger: Do Not Operate Signs

The most recognisable LOTO sign. Applied at the point of isolation when LOTO is in place — either as part of a fixed sign holder or as a tag attached to the physical lock. AS1319-compliant ‘DO NOT OPERATE’ signs use the Danger format: red header with white text, white body with the isolation instruction.

Important: these signs should never substitute for a physical lock. The sign communicates the isolation status; the lock prevents it from being reversed.

3. Lockout/Tagout Procedure Signs

Mounted near the equipment or at the work area entry, procedure signs outline the steps of the LOTO process specific to that equipment. For complex machinery with multiple energy sources, a laminated procedure card covering each isolation point is appropriate.

4. LOTO Station Signs

If your workplace uses a centralised LOTO station — a board or cabinet where locks, tags and LOTO equipment are stored — it must be clearly signed. This makes the equipment accessible to all workers including contractors and labour hire who may not have received a site tour.

Choosing the Right Lockout Tagout Tags for Your Site

Not all lockout tags are equal. When selecting tags for Australian industrial environments, consider the following:

  • Material durability: Tags must withstand your environment — heat, UV exposure, oils, chemicals or moisture. Polypropylene is the preferred material for most industrial applications.
  • UV stability: Outdoor or high-UV environments require UV stable printing to ensure the tag remains legible throughout its working life.
  • Customisation: Tags should include fields for worker name, plant ID, and date. Custom-printed tags with your site’s specific requirements are the most compliant option.
  • Standardisation: All tags across a site should use the same format so any worker can read them quickly under pressure.

Building a Compliant LOTO Signage System: A Practical Approach

A complete system does not need to be complex. Follow these five steps:

  1. Map your energy sources. Walk your site with the maintenance team. Identify every electrical isolator, pneumatic shut-off, hydraulic control valve and any other energy control device that forms part of a maintenance procedure.
  2. Assign sign types to each point. For each isolation device: Does it have a permanent identification sign? If LOTO is applied here, is there a compliant ‘Do Not Operate’ sign or tag system?
  3. Identify stored energy hazards. Mark any equipment that retains energy after isolation — capacitors, UPS, variable speed drives. These require additional warning signage beyond the standard isolation label.
  4. Establish the LOTO station. Set up a centralised LOTO station and sign it clearly. Ensure it contains sufficient locks and tags for all workers who may simultaneously perform LOTO on site.
  5. Review with your maintenance team. Walk through the system with the workers who use it. If they can navigate the LOTO procedure using only the signage — without referring to a manual — your system is working.

Common LOTO Signage Questions

Can we use commercially printed tags instead of standardised Lockout / Tagout tags?

Yes, provided they meet AS1319 format requirements. Custom printing is acceptable — and often preferable for site-specific information. The Danger format, colour coding and minimum content requirements must be met.

How long should LOTO signs last?

In industrial environments, expect to replace signs every 3-5 years. In clean environments, well-made polycarbonate or aluminium signs can last 10 or more years. The test is legibility: if the sign requires close inspection to read, replace it.

Do LOTO requirements apply to low-voltage (240V) equipment?

Yes. 240V is more than sufficient to cause fatal electrocution. LOTO requirements apply to any isolation procedure where contact with live parts could occur, regardless of voltage.
